MOT History

15 pass 5 fail
Pass 20 Feb 2026 165,825 miles

Brake disc worn, but not excessively all discs (1.1.14 (a) (i))

general underside corrosion

Pass 13 Mar 2025 151,188 miles

Rear Brake hose has slight corrosion to ferrule both side (1.1.12 (f) (i))

Rear Sub-frame corroded but not seriously weakened (5.3.3 (b) (i))

Rear Suspension arm pin or bush worn but not resulting in excessive movement both sides (5.3.4 (a) (i))

Pass 11 Mar 2024 146,876 miles

Nearside Front Tyre worn close to legal limit/worn on edge (5.2.3 (e))

Offside Rear Tyre worn close to legal limit/worn on edge (5.2.3 (e))

Pass 15 Feb 2023 138,272 miles
Pass 11 Mar 2022 128,760 miles

Oil leak, but not excessive (8.4.1 (a) (i))

Rear Child Seat fitted not allowing full inspection of adult belt X3 seats fitted in second row ()

Pass 4 Mar 2021 118,132 miles

Oil leak, but not excessive (8.4.1 (a) (i))

Pass 12 Mar 2020 115,403 miles
Fail 12 Mar 2020 115,402 miles

Nearside Front Suspension arm ball joint excessively worn (5.3.4 (a) (i))

Offside Front Suspension arm ball joint excessively worn (5.3.4 (a) (i))

Pass 14 Mar 2019 102,754 miles

both front tyres wearing on edges

Fail 14 Mar 2019 102,754 miles

Offside Front Coil spring fractured or broken (5.3.1 (b) (i))

Nearside Rear Brake pad(s) wearing thin (1.1.13 (a) (ii))

both front tyres wearing on edges

Pass 2 Mar 2018 91,736 miles
Fail 1 Mar 2018 91,736 miles

Brake fluid warning lamp illuminated (3.6.G.2)

Nearside Front Mechanical brake component has restricted free movement (3.5.1k)

Nearside Rear Tyre has ply or cords exposed (4.1.D.1b)

Front Brake pad(s) wearing thin (3.5.1g)

Pass 15 Mar 2017 81,731 miles
Fail 11 Mar 2017 81,730 miles

Electronic parking brake control defective so that it cannot be satisfactorily operated (3.1.3c)

Electronic parking brake warning indicates a malfunction (3.1.7)

Offside Front Anti-roll bar linkage has excessive play in a ball joint (2.4.G.2)

Offside Rear Air suspension unit leaking (2.4.D.2)

Parking brake: efficiency below requirements (3.7.C.1b)

Front Brake pad(s) wearing thin (3.5.1g)

Pass 16 Apr 2016 73,165 miles
Fail 16 Apr 2016 73,162 miles

Nearside Rear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m (4.1.E.1)

Offside Rear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m (4.1.E.1)

Pass 31 Mar 2015 65,160 miles
Pass 14 Apr 2014 56,358 miles

Child seat fitted not allowing full inspection of adult belt

Pass 2 Apr 2013 41,692 miles
Pass 2 Apr 2012 28,705 miles

Nearside Front Suspension arm has slight play in a ball joint (2.4.G.2)

Offside Front Suspension arm has slight play in a pin/bush (2.4.G.2)

Offside Rear Anti-roll bar linkage has slight play in a pin/bush (2.4.G.2)

LT09 CXP is a 2009 BMW X5 in Silver with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 2009 BMW X5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.2% with a typical mileage of 86,008 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a BMW X5 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,544 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LT09 CXP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The BMW X5 typ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 17 years old, this BMW X5 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
